You just need to get an idea locked on what the market prices is, to know how "good" a sale is.

$5 off AR mags could be good--but not if it's on $25 20 round mags.

Sadly, you will also get a feeling for what the price ought to be, too. There are so many AR mags out there, the 20 rounders ought to be $10, and the 30s about $15--instead of $20 and $30 respectively. Certainly should not be $30 for GI discard "rebuilt" with "green" followers. Whereas a new-in-the-box Magpul might be a good deal at $30.

Try primary arms http://www.primaryarms.com/ for the AR mags and more stuff on AR's. Have seen magpuls for around ten bucks on occasion with faster shipping than psa. Have a decent line of red dot scopes as well.

CDNN on pistol and sometimes AR mags. Often the pistol mag deals are the Mecgar equivalent (Mecgar makes a lot of mags for manufacturers but also sells under their label).

Topgun USA on some pistol mags that are relatively hard to get such as SIGs

Midway USA sometimes on pistol mags and AR mags.

Brownells has some occasional deals on AR mags. Sometimes on specific pistols there will be a modest sale.

I have also picked up magazines from Numrich at a good price during the last hi capacity magazine scare (after the NY Safe Act bs)
